Overview:
Reporting to the Chief Executive Officer and the Editor-in-Chief of the company, the Executive Editor is a full-time role based in Washington, DC. This role will be responsible for furthering the editorial and business objectives of an emerging media company. A successful candidate will desire a collaborative work environment, have excellent organizational and leadership skills, and strong problem-solving ability. If you have an editorial mind and possess the practical focus of an operations manager, this position is for you.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
· Coordinate all editorial for growing website, suite of newsletters and multiple podcasts.
· Manage contributor network editorial and payment schedule, in coordination with Director of Talent and Operations.
· Commission thoughtful and engaging stand-alone articles on politics, policy and culture that align with The Dispatch brand and mission.
· Evaluate over-the-transom submissions for tone and substance.
· Assist staff writers and contributors with all aspects of conception, execution and completion of stories.
· Scout new contributors and potential new hires.
· Supervise internal and external fact-checking operations.
Skills and Qualifications
· Background in editing, content management.
· Creative thinking on story ideas, and execution.
· Experience commissioning and editing pieces for publication.
· Exceptional copyediting skills, and attention to detail.
· Experience managing writers and editors.
· Background in reporting is a plus.
· Familiarity with American politics, media, conservatism/classical liberalism.
· Basic knowledge of podcasting/audio journalism is a plus.
· Understanding of the rapidly-changing digital media landscape, and various revenue strategies.
